GlenAllachie
Scotland
Single Malt
In mid-2019, the GlenAllachie Distillery launched a trio of single malts, each one having enjoyed a different cask finish. For the 10 year old expression, the whisky was firstly aged in American oak barrels, then moved over to Port pipes for its remaining maturation. Look out for an inviting ruby hue and chocolate, fruity notes on the palate with this one.

Tried at a tasting event - this is a decent whisky but tastes too young in my opinion. There is a harshness and a spiciness to it which takes away from it's potential as, before they hit, the flavours are really nice and you can really get those port characteristics. The spiciness and youthfulness makes this a miss for me though. At the tasting it was suggested we mix this expression with GlenAllachie's 12 yr Pedro Ximenez - and we did - and it was really, really good. Not an option for a lot of people I know but combined they were excellent - the spiciness was toned down completely, the youthfulness had gone, and the complexity of both the whiskies, when blended, just amped up. If they made an expression with these two combined I'd definitely be in for a bottle.
